I read this book after enjoying the movie, and I enjoyed it but ultimately preferred the movie. Tom Blyth's portrayal of Coriolanus had more depth and ambiguity than he had in the novel, which made the story inherently more interesting."And who wouldn't rather be the victor than the defeated?"
